Inaugural Youth Poet Laureate Amanda Gorman performs her Independence Day poem
In honor of Independence Day, we asked 21-year-old Amanda Gorman the inaugural youth poet laureate of the United States, to write a poem. The Boston Pops Orchestra, conducted by Keith Lockhart, performs one of the most famous July Fourth concerts each year. We asked them to bring music to her composition, "Believer's Hymn for the Republic."
